#497a8b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#497a8b is composed of 28.6% red, 47.8%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#497a8b color hex could be obtained by blending #92f4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#497a8b color description : Dark moderate blue.

#497a8b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#497a8b has RGB values of R:73, G:122,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4815499.

Shades and Tints of #497a8b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05090a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#497a8b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6a is the less saturated color, while #089acc is the most saturated one.
